Bakersfield welcomes baker's dozen to faculty and staff

Posted

Bakersfield High School and Middle School students will have new leadership this year in Principal Stephanie Guffey and Assistant Principal Melissa Hayes.

Nine new additions to the high school faculty and staff have been made for the 2023-24 school year, and four more to the elementary team.

At the middle and high school Tresa Lester will teach high school math; Legan Tiller, high school science; Erlene Tackitt, high school special education; Steven Blasdel and Sarah Amburgy, middle school special education; Suzanne Montague, middle school social studies and volleyball coach; Megan Peuppke, RootEd Advisor, mental health and high school science; Michael Mahan, athletic director and coach for girls basketball and golf; Destiny Johnson, middle school English and assistant middle school volleyball coach; Kelby Hutsler, track and cross country coach; and Cainen McGinnis, assistant boys basketball coach and paraprofessional.

New elementary faculty and staff are first grade teacher Jackie Blasdel, fourth grade teacher Jennifer Coffey, special education teacher Moriah Combs and cafeteria worker Davannia Norton.

New student registration was held Tuesday. Anyone who missed that day and who needs to enroll a new student should call 417-284-7333.

Open house for all grades will be from 5:30 to 7:30 p.m. Aug. 17.

Meal prices for this school year are $1.25 for breakfast for all students, and $2.15 for high school lunches or $1.90 for elementary lunches.
